Don't search by "Address"... That is Bitcoin Core interpreting the hex value stored in the wallet as a Bitcoin address which will be different to the address shown on another network. Instead, search by TransactionID as that doesn't change across the networks.

In Bitcoin Core, goto the "Transactions" tab, right click one of the transactions and select "Copy Transaction ID". Then copy/paste that into block explorers for the most common altcoins (ie. Litecoin, Dogecoin etc)
